hfs_brec_update_parent() may hit BUG_ON() if the first record of both a
leaf node and its parent are changed, and if this forces the parent to
be split. It is not possible for this to happen on a valid hfs
filesystem because the index nodes have fixed length keys.For reasons I ignore, the hfs module does have support for a number of
hfsplus features. A corrupt btree header may report variable length
keys and trigger this BUG, so it's better to fix it.Link: http://lkml.kernel.org/r/cf9b02d57f806217a2b1bf5db8c3e39730d8f603.1535682463.git.ernesto.mnd.fernandez@gmail.com

This bug is triggered whenever hfs_brec_update_parent() needs to split
the root node. The height of the btree is not increased, which leaves
the new node orphaned and its records lost. It is not possible for this
to happen on a valid hfs filesystem because the index nodes have fixed
length keys.For reasons I ignore, the hfs module does have support for a number of
hfsplus features. A corrupt btree header may report variable length
keys and trigger this bug, so it's better to fix it.Link: http://lkml.kernel.org/r/9750b1415685c4adca10766895f6d5ef12babdb0.1535682463.git.ernesto.mnd.fernandez@gmail.com

hfs_find_exit() expects fd->bnode to be NULL after a search has failed.
hfs_brec_insert() may instead set it to an error-valued pointer. Fix
this to prevent a crash.Link: http://lkml.kernel.org/r/53d9749a029c41b4016c495fc5838c9dba3afc52.1530294815.git.ernesto.mnd.fernandez@gmail.com

Many source files in the tree are missing licensing information, which
makes it harder for compliance tools to determine the correct license.By default all files without license information are under the default
license of the kernel, which is GPL version 2.Update the files which contain no license information with the 'GPL-2.0'
SPDX license identifier. The SPDX identifier is a legally binding
shorthand, which can be used instead of the full boiler plate text.This patch is based on work done by Thomas Gleixner and Kate Stewart and
Philippe Ombredanne.How this work was done:
Patches were generated and checked against linux-4.14-rc6 for a subset of
the use cases:
- file had no licensing information it it.
- file was a */uapi/* one with no licensing information in it,
- file was a */uapi/* one with existing licensing information,Further patches will be generated in subsequent months to fix up cases
where non-standard license headers were used, and references to license
had to be inferred by heuristics based on keywords.The analysis to determine which SPDX License Identifier to be applied to
a file was done in a spreadsheet of side by side results from of the
output of two independent scanners (ScanCode & Windriver) producing SPDX
tag:value files created by Philippe Ombredanne. Philippe prepared the
base worksheet, and did an initial spot review of a few 1000 files.The 4.13 kernel was the starting point of the analysis with 60,537 files
assessed. Kate Stewart did a file by file comparison of the scanner
results in the spreadsheet to determine which SPDX license identifier(s)
to be applied to the file. She confirmed any determination that was not
immediately clear with lawyers working with the Linux Foundation.Criteria used to select files for SPDX license identifier tagging was:
- Files considered eligible had to be source code files.
- Make and config files were included as candidates if they contained >5
lines of source
- File already had some variant of a license header in it (even if

hfs seems prone to bad things when it encounters on disk corruption. Many
values are read from disk, and used as lengths to memcpy, as an example.
This patch fixes up several of these problematic cases.o sanity check the on-disk maximum key lengths on mount
(these are set to a defined value at mkfs time and shouldn't differ)
o check on-disk node keylens against the maximum key length for each tree
o fix hfs_btree_open so that going out via free_tree: doesn't wind
up in hfs_releasepage, which wants to follow the very pointer
we were trying to set up:
HFS_SB(sb)->cat_tree = hfs_btree_open()
...
failure gets to hfs_releasepage and tries
to follow HFS_SB(sb)->cat_treeTested with the fsfuzzer; it survives more than it used to.
